Olympia Work Preparer Base Maintenance | Aircraft maintenance - Wat ga je doen? During Base Maintenance, aircraft undergo major maintenance checks in the hangar. Every day an aircraft is grounded costs the customer money, so tight preparation is worth its weight in gold. As Work Preparer, you're responsible for preparing, coordinating, and supporting maintenance projects. You compile work packages and task cards according to the applicable maintenance documentation, so mechanics can get to work immediately and in a structured way. You make sure parts, tools, documentation, and manpower are available at the right time. You monitor progress, flag bottlenecks, and liaise with the manager, mechanics, and other departments. You also handle the administrative processing and post-calculation of projects. Waar ga je werken? You'll be working for a leading, independent aircraft maintenance organization in the Maastricht region. You'll be the right hand of the Base Maintenance manager, and you'll be part of a small, international team that works closely together around every aircraft that comes in for maintenance. It's a full-time office-based position, working office hours. Sustainability Policy StartGreen Capital's sustainability policy forms the basis for all financing and investment decisions within its funds. The policy guides decision-making, portfolio management, and reporting, and is an integral part of how StartGreen Capital fulfills its role as an impact fund manager. In addition, the policy provides direction for its own business operations in the area of sustainability. StartGreen Capital has the explicit objective of achieving measurable positive impact on the environment and society through its funds, combined with careful management of sustainability and ESG risks. All StartGreen Capital funds have a sustainable investment objective and qualify as sustainable investments within the meaning of Article 9 of the Sustainable Finance Disclosure Regulation (SFDR). These themes serve as the guideline for the selection, assessment, and monitoring of investments and financing. StartGreen Capital finances companies and projects that contribute to a fossil-free, circular, and inclusive economy and that achieve demonstrably positive social and environmental effects. Sustainable Development Goals StartGreen Capital uses the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) as a reference framework for determining, measuring, and communicating the intended and realized impact of its investments. The 17 SDGs form a global framework for addressing social and ecological challenges and act as a collective roadmap toward a sustainable, inclusive, and future-proof society. StartGreen Capital exclusively finances companies and projects that demonstrably contribute to at least one of the SDGs. To make this contribution transparent and measurable, StartGreen works with objective and, where possible, aggregatable impact indicators (KPIs), such as renewable energy generated, avoided or reduced CO₂ emissions, and employment created.
